Linux系统以其强大的命令行工具和灵活的配置能力,成为开发轻量级服务器的理想选择。通过简单的命令,开发者可以快速搭建一个高效且资源占用低的小程序服务器。
安装Linux系统后,使用apt或yum等包管理器可以轻松安装必要的服务软件,如Nginx、Apache或Lighttpd。这些工具提供了基础的Web服务功能,适合运行小型应用。
通过编写Shell脚本,可以实现自动化部署和管理。例如,利用crontab定时执行任务,或者通过systemd管理服务进程,确保服务器稳定运行。

AI生成的示意图,仅供参考
对于需要数据库支持的应用,可以使用SQLite或MariaDB等轻量级数据库。它们占用资源少,配置简单,非常适合小型项目。
命令行的强大之处在于其灵活性和可定制性。开发者可以通过组合多个命令,实现复杂的功能,而无需依赖图形界面。
在Linux环境下,安全设置同样重要。通过防火墙规则、权限管理和日志监控,可以有效提升服务器的安全性。
总体而言,Linux的命令行环境为构建轻量级服务器提供了丰富的工具和便捷的操作方式,是开发者不可忽视的重要技能。